Roger Hayter ([EMAIL PROTECTED]) wrote:

> I have a permanent node which has managed to contact a 
> group of seed nodes about 500 times after 130000 trials.

I would imagine something is wrong with your computer, firewall,
network, Java VM, freenet.conf, etc.  Here's what I've got on a
non-transient build-535 node with Sun Java 1.4.1_01 on Linux 2.4.18
after two weeks:

Number of node references: 49
Contacted node references: 46
Backed off node references: 3
Total Trials: 642128
Total Successes: 391024
Implementation: freenet.node.rt.CPAlgoRoutingTable

This is not to say that it's totally impossible you've found a Freenet
bug.  But I'd suspect a configuration error is more likely.
